Neglecting Ventilation Requirements



While numerous homeowners concentrate on the aesthetic and architectural elements of roof installation, ignoring ventilation demands can bring about serious lasting effects. Correct air flow is essential for regulating temperature level and dampness degrees in your attic, avoiding issues like mold development, wood rot, and ice dams. If flooring contractors in san antonio do not mount appropriate air flow, you're establishing your roofing up for failure.

To prevent this error, initially, analyze your home's certain ventilation requirements. A well balanced system usually consists of both consumption and exhaust vents to promote air movement. Ensure you've set up soffit vents along the eaves and ridge vents at the peak of your roof covering. This combination allows hot air to leave while cooler air enters, keeping your attic room room comfortable.

Additionally, take into consideration the type of roof material you've selected. Some materials may call for additional ventilation methods. Double-check your neighborhood building ordinance for air flow guidelines, as they can differ substantially.

Ultimately, do not forget to examine your air flow system routinely. Obstructions from particles or insulation can hamper air movement, so maintain those vents clear.
